Not many economic dockets and events scheduled for today and all with low to medium volatility risks associated.
Data released so far:
- Australia: RBA released minutes of the meeting. House prices rose by 4.1 percent in the fourth quarter, up 7.7 percent from a year ago.
Upcoming:
- Switzerland: SECO economic forecasts report will be published at 6:45 GMT, followed by February trade balance report at 7:00 GMT.
- Spain: Trade balance report will be released at 9:00 GMT.
- United Kingdom: RPI, CPI, PPI, and HPI inflation report will be released at 9:30 GMT, along with net borrowing in public sector for February.
- Eurozone: Finance ministers will be meeting in Brussels.
- United States: Fed’s William Dudley is scheduled to speak at 11:00 GMT. Current account balance for the fourth quarter will be reported at 12:30 GMT. Redbook index will be released at 12:55 GMT. Fed’s George is scheduled to speak at 16:00 GMT and Mester is scheduled to speak at 22:00 GMT.
- New Zealand: Global dairy auction is scheduled today.
- Canada: Retail sales report for January will be released at 12:30 GMT.
- Japan: February trade balance report will be released at 23:50 GMT, along with BoJ minutes of the meeting.
- Auction: U.S. will auction 1-month bills at 16:30 GMT.
